One of my favorite landscape images, this image was captured in near darkness utilizing a 30-second exposure to capture the last subtle light of twilight gently illuminating the west facing ridge lines. From my vantage point I could barely see these ridge lines nearly a mile away. Twilight…aka “the blue hour”, is known for its blue hue in the sky and that it casts on its subjects. Working with soft light like this can produce unique tones, textures, and moods, one especially showcased well by the simple color palette of Southern Utah.
